I've just started experimenting with Agendus on Palm OS, using a Sony Clie S-300. I am currently a user of Franklin Planner Software and have removed the native ToDo application from ROM. I am having trouble editing the ToDo items previously entered in Agendus. Is this because of the missing native ToDo application, or am i doing something else wrong? I can change the priority or the due date, but cannnot return to the edit screen for the item.

Why did you remove the native to do application...it uses the same database and agendus can be uninstalled if necessary and you retain all your todos....AGendus addes codes to the notes of the standard todo database so it can always be used by the native to do application.

I findit useful at times to go to the native todo since it does not have to process things ..like for a food shopping list....it appears in both but it is simpler times to go to the native to do just to look at it.

This annoyed me for a while too... you can just click down and hold on the item you want to edit - after a second or so you get a pop-up menu, and the first item is edit/view... that should sort you out
